The Rise of Voice Search: A New Era in SEO
Voice search is rapidly gaining popularity due to the increasing use of virtual assistants like Siri, Alexa, Google Assistant, and others. According to recent studies, over 50% of all searches are expected to be voice searches by 2025. These searches are generally more conversational and focused on local intent. For example, instead of typing “best pizza in Oklahoma City,” users may simply ask, “Where is the best pizza near me?”
This shift in how consumers search has significant implications for businesses in Oklahoma City. Voice search optimization is no longer optional — it’s essential for local businesses that want to remain visible in a competitive market.
Voice search results prioritize local businesses more than ever before, making it crucial for businesses to adopt SEO strategies that cater to this new form of search. The key to success lies in optimizing your content for "Near Me" queries and understanding how voice search differs from traditional text-based searches.
Why "Near Me" Queries Matter for Local SEO
"Near Me" searches have been on the rise as consumers increasingly rely on their smartphones and voice assistants to find products or services nearby. These types of searches are highly localized, and users expect quick, relevant results that are close to their location.
For Oklahoma City businesses, optimizing for "Near Me" searches can help you:
-
Increase Visibility: Appearing in "Near Me" search results puts your business in front of customers who are actively searching for products or services within your local area.
-
Drive More Foot Traffic: Many "Near Me" queries have high commercial intent, meaning users are looking to make a purchase soon. By optimizing your website for these queries, you can attract more people to your physical store or office.
-
Enhance Local Relevance: Google prioritizes locally relevant content in voice search results, so ranking well for "Near Me" queries enhances your business’s relevance in the eyes of local searchers.
How to Optimize for Voice Search and "Near Me" Queries in OKC
Optimizing for voice search requires a slightly different approach than traditional SEO. Voice search queries are typically longer, more conversational, and often include phrases like “how,” “what,” “where,” and “near me.” Let’s explore the strategies that will help your Oklahoma City business rank higher in voice search results and "Near Me" queries.
1. Focus on Natural Language and Conversational Keywords
One of the defining features of voice search is its conversational nature. Unlike traditional text-based searches, users tend to phrase voice searches in a more natural, question-like format. For example, instead of typing “Oklahoma City SEO services,” a user may ask, “What is the best SEO company near me in Oklahoma City?”
To optimize for voice search, it’s essential to incorporate long-tail, conversational keywords into your content. Think about how your target audience might phrase their queries when using voice search, and tailor your keyword strategy accordingly. Use question-based phrases like:
- “Where can I find SEO services near me in Oklahoma City?”
- “What are the best restaurants in Oklahoma City?”
- “How to find an affordable SEO expert near me?”

2. Optimize Your Google My Business Listing
One of the most important factors for ranking in local search results, especially for "Near Me" queries, is having an optimized Google My Business (GMB) profile. Since Google relies heavily on GMB for local search results, ensuring your profile is complete and up to date is crucial.
Key elements to optimize within your GMB listing include:
- Business Name: Ensure your business name is consistent with your official branding.
- Address and Phone Number: Verify that your NAP (name, address, and phone number) is accurate and consistent across all online directories.
- Categories: Choose the most relevant categories for your business to improve local relevance.
- Hours of Operation: Include accurate business hours, especially if they vary by day.
- Customer Reviews: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ews. Positive reviews not only enhance your reputation but also improve your visibility in local search results.
By optimizing your GMB profile, you increase your chances of appearing in "Near Me" voice search queries, which often pull data directly from this source.
3. Improve Website Load Speed and Mobile Optimization
Voice search queries are typically made on mobile devices, so it’s essential that your website is mobile-friendly and loads quickly. Google uses mobile-first indexing, meaning it predominantly uses the mobile version of your site to determine rankings.
- Responsive Design: Make sure your website’s design is responsive, meaning it adapts to different screen sizes, from smartphones to tablets.
- Speed Optimization: A fast-loading website enhances the user experience and is favored by search engines. Compress images, leverage browser caching, and use content delivery networks (CDNs) to reduce load times.
For local businesses, mobile optimization is especially important for appearing in "Near Me" searches. The quicker your site loads and the easier it is to navigate on mobile, the better your chances of ranking in voice search results.
4. Create Localized Content
Voice search is inherently local, so creating localized content is essential for ranking in "Near Me" searches. Focus on content that speaks to your local audience and incorporates local keywords and geographic references. For example, if your business is an SEO agency in Oklahoma City, you could write blog posts such as:
- “Top SEO Strategies for Oklahoma City Businesses”
- “How to Choose the Best SEO Expert in OKC”
By targeting local content and addressing the specific needs of your community, you improve your chances of appearing in local voice searches and increase your relevance in the eyes of search engines.
5. Use Structured Data (Schema Markup)
Schema markup helps search engines better understand the content on your website. By adding structured data to your site, you can provide more detailed information about your business, such as your services, pricing, location, and reviews.
For "Near Me" voice search, schema markup is especially useful for providing location-specific data. It helps Google’s algorithms recognize that your business is relevant to local searches, making it easier for your site to appear in voice search results.
6. Optimize for Featured Snippets
Featured snippets are the boxed information that appears at the top of Google’s search results in response to specific questions. Voice search often pulls from featured snippets to provide answers.
To optimize for featured snippets, structure your content in a way that answers common questions related to your industry. Use bullet points, numbered lists, and concise, clear answers to questions to increase the likelihood that your content will be pulled as a snippet.
